Little Alice has a hot box that is about 24 X 24. She has lived in it for just over 2 years. She went into it at 17 pounds and is now over 55 pounds. She now has a heating pad which makes it even worse. She will not spend the winter in our kitchen as she is much too big for that. She will have to spend her time in my hot tub room, a greenhouse, and she will be able to go outside and in her condo like she did last winter.

The hot tub room greenhouse will have a furnace along with her heat pad. Her condo will have an oil radiator and lights but she will not spend the nights out there. She is well trained to come into the hot tub room at night.

We have had to screw the heat pad down because she likes to dig to go to sleep and whips it out. That makes it very hard to clean. So I clean the top surface daily and unscrew to clean once a week.

She will be getting a 100 gallon metal stock tank laying on it's side next week to replace her little hot box. I will have both boxes in there until she gets used to the larger new one. I think I am going to paint it pink for my little girlie...LOL
